brigas-team team mailing list archive
-
brigas-team team
-
Mailing list archive
-
Message #00102
Mais tarefas para o projeto (LEIAM)
Pessoal, nessa altura do campeonato é mto difícil das pessoas q não
estão participando efetivamente começarem a participar com CÓDIGO para
o projeto, já q tem mta coisa codificada e está num ritmo razoável,
colocar mais pessoas pra codificar iria diminuir o ritmo ao invés de
aumentar.
Eu sinceramente esperava ver algum interesse dos participantes, mas
infelizmente não foi o caso.
Oq eu quero com esse email é passsar outras tarefas além de codificar
para o grupo.
1- Colocar o python distutils em todos os 'pacotes'. Pacote aqui seria
cada aplicação separada, como o servidor de truco, o servidor de
jogos, os control point e o cliente q será criado. O distutils é uma
ferramenta para um sistema de empacotamento de aplicações python, ele
gera principalmente o setup.py. Tem vasta documentação sobre isso na
internet.
2- Rodar o control point existente no maemo. Usando o scratchbox ou um
dispositvo real mesmo. Precisa instalar o brisa no maemo pra isso.
3- Rodar o elementary_test no maemo. O site packages.enlightenment.org
tem pacotes .deb pra arquitetura armel, é a arquitetura do n800. Já
tem o python-elementary prontinho em .deb pra instalar, mas
sinceramente não sei como faz pra instalar .deb de terceiros no maemo.
4- Criar o .deb de todos os pacotes. É pra criar de acordo com o
debian maintainer, e não pelos côcos, ou seja, é pra usar o diretório
debian, o arquivo rules e etc. Quem pegar essa tarefa vai entender do
q eu estou falando.
5?- Talvez seja necessário criar um pacotão do cliente pra maemo, já
com todas as depedências incluídas (elementary e suas deps.), em C eu
diria compilar estáticamente, mas sinceramente se tratando de bindings
pra python eu não faço a menor de ideia se existe compilação estática.
Isso vai depender da dificuldade da tarefa 3, se for mto complicado
instalar as coisas o melhor vai ser criar um único mesmo.
6- Aprender Edje e Elementary!? A interface creio eu q vai ser a parte
mais demorada nesse projeto. O Baltazar q topou contribuir para o
nosso projeto (vlw mesmo Bal!) ficou de estudar elementary e fazer uma
aplicação exemplo utilizando toolbar, pager e list, como eu tinha dito
num email sobre as tarefas. Mas ainda falta alguém para o edje, o edje
é quem vai cuidar das cartas, pq o elementary é só pra botões,
toolbar, etc. O Edje é para imagens, eu fiz bastante coisa com o edje
no ETruco, ele é um ponto de partida pra quem quiser fazer isso.
--
=======================
Diogo Dutra Albuquerque
Meu Curriculum Lattes: http://lattes.cnpq.br/3624796077679922
Follow ups